Irepair Works

Closed
Call
1358 South St
Philadelphia, PA 19147

Irepairworks is a reputable electronics repair shop based in Philadelphia, PA.

Specializing in fixing a wide range of devices, they offer efficient and reliable repair services to their customers.

Generated from their business information

Own this business?
See a problem?

You might also like